The corruption ravaging the Niger Delta Development Company, NDDC, has exploded into the public domain. As the Corona Virus pandemic was making inroad into Nigeria, the henchmen and women at the NDDC were busying themselves at siphoning the resources of the nation. Within one month early this year the company awarded a contract to the tune of 40 billion Naira.

Funny enough, such contract with huge sum did not follow laid down rules before it was awarded and paid for in full. The stench in the NDDC got to the President of Nigeria at his base in Aso Rock, Abuja, so much that he couldn’t stand it but called for a forensic audit of the company. That call by the president has now opened a can of worms on the NDDC. The sickening manner the funds of the company have been looted is beyond words.

The National Assembly has also weighed into the whole corruption saga of the NDDC, conducting an investigation of it own. Many players, including the Minister Godswill Akpabio have appeared before the law makers, but one person that has blown open the sleaze in the NDDC is Mrs Joy Nunieh, the immediate Acting Managing Director of the company who was late to the meeting of the law makers but chose instead to address the press about the culture of corruption in the company.

In the clip that has now gone viral on the social media, the former MD points the accusing finger in the direction of Mr Akpabio. Joy Nunieh accused Godswill Akpabio who is the Minister of the Niger Delta of bombing a Nigerian oil pipeline to cover up his corrupt acts. She also accused Akpabio of forcing her to take an oath of secrecy, to award emergency contracts. “He told me to take an oath. Though he denied that, he told me three times. We had a reconciliation at the Villa in the office of Sarki Abba, the SA (Special Assistant) to the President on Domestics.”

“For instance, he told me to raise a memo to fraudulently award emergency contracts for flood victims in the Niger Delta,” she explained.

Akpabio while responding to Nunieh allegations in a separate interview said the former NDDC MD has temper problems which can be confirmed by her four former husbands.
